Packaging and packaging waste

Decree of (indicate the date) amending the 2014 Packaging Management Decree related to the implementation of the Directive (EU) 2018/852 of the European Parliament and of the Council of the 30 May 2018 amending the Directive 94/62/EC on the packaging and packaging waste and the application of general rules concerning extended producer responsibility regimes as from 1 January 2023

Article I, parts C and D may contain technical regulations.

As part of the implementation of the Directive (EU) 2018/851, the decree sets circular objectives and new recycling objectives.
The circular objectives set out in the article I, part C, and the recycling objectives set out in article I, part D, all concern minimum standards for which the producer or importer is the standard addressee. Because reusing prevents the generation of packaging waste, both standards have a different scope. The circular objective concerns the total quantity of reused packaging and recycled packaging material compared to the total weight of packaging material used for the inclusion, the protection, the loading, the delivery, or the presentation of products placed on the market.
The recycling objective concerns the proportion of recycled packaging waste compared to the total amount of packaging waste.
A provision of mutual recognition is not necessary because the obligations contained in the decree do not result in the non-admission of foreign products.
